Viktor Fasth
The Ducks have traded Viktor Fasth to the Oilers for a 2014 fifth-round pick and a 2015 third-round pick.

The emergence of Frederik Andersen allowed the Ducks to send Fasth to the Oilers for future assets. Fasth has gone 2-2-1 with a 2.95 GAA and .885 SV% in an injury riddled season with the Ducks. After the Oilers started the season with Devan Dubnyk and Jason LaBarbera they now have Ben Scrivens and Fasth, which is a nice upgrade.

Viktor Fasth
Fasth (lower-body) has been assigned to Norfolk on a long-term injury conditioning loan.

Fasth has been out since October 18 and has seen his replacement Frederik Andersen go 6-0-0 with a 1.41 GAA and .952 SV%. It will be interesting to see how the Ducks handle this situation - Fasth was great in his rookie season and signed a two-year extension, but will the Ducks send a 6-0 Andersen down?
